SAGE Research Methods is a robust and authoritative database that contains resources relating to the research process. It is the ultimate methods library with more than 1000 books, reference works, journal articles, and instructional videos by world-leading academics from across the social sciences, including the largest collection of qualitative methods books available online from any scholarly publisher. The site is designed to guide users to the content they need to learn a little or a lot about their method.

To access SAGE Research Methods, Select the databases tab on the library home page.

 

 

Select the letter and scroll through the alphabetical listing and click on "SAGE Research Methods".
